WebJun 1, 2024 · To do this in CHIRP, click on the “Settings” tab on the left side and adjust the following: Basic Settings Carrier Squelch Level - 5 Beep - uncheck this box Display Mode (A) - Name Display Mode (B) - Name Advanced Settings Voice - OFF Squelch Tail Eliminate (HT to HT) - uncheck this box Squelch Tail Eliminate (repeater) - OFF WebFeb 4, 2014 · Setting a channel to Tone Mode: Cross and Cross Mode: Tone->Tone and both tones the same is the very definition of TSQL. WebIf you want to completely disable transmit, go to "Settings" (top left corner, under CHIRP options bar), "other settings", and un check "VHF/UHF TX enabled". So either set up the MDF settings in the radio that way you want them using menu 21 [MDF-A] and menu 22 [MDF-B] and then download into CHIRP and make your "skip" changes. Or make the changes within CHIRP along with your "skip" settings. Settings -> Basic Settings -> …
